Transaction ed3ab1c851cbb4c2604771ff91bd4899b9aa688c747c054626d34c2971b436d3
1 Input
1 Output
-
ed3ab1c851cbb4c2604771ff91bd4899b9aa688c747c054626d34c2971b436d3:0
- value
- 20138667
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c5e7f51aed2cae6079e917ddb87b0ca9137e941
- address
- bc1qh30875dw6t9wvpu7j97ahpase2gn062pjwj4gd